Compute Leonardo's ratio
Compute from an object of class aRchi the Leonardo's ratio (i.e R_ratio) at node, axis, branch order or tree level.

position |
At which position from the node R_ratio had to be estimated. Either a numeric or a character. Use a numeric multiple of ten to select the distance from the node in cm where R ratio has to be estimated (e.g 10 for 10cm from the node). Use the % sign after a multiple of ten to select the distance from the node in percentage of the length of the parent and daughters segments (e.g 50% for an estimation at mid-length of the segments). Note that 0 is accepted and correspond to the closest position from the node. |
